Unfortunately the Giants don’t shop at Whole Foods so they’ve decided to push ahead with their own brand of madness – on Wednesday Sept. 5 AT&T Park will host its first ever Yoga Day. Entry gets you a 8-9:15am on-field yoga session and a ticket to the evening game. You can bring your own mat and the Giants will give you one too, so now you can really strut your stuff at the market.

Also Michael Franti will be there, because music. I had to google Michael Franti to figure out who he is… basically, if it’s not tumblr rap or chillwave or seapunk then I have never heard of it. Michael Franti has a band called Spearhead, which is a cool name for a video game or a D&D monster. He promises to play music appropriate for deep stretching and earnest exhaling.
